You should think of the current K-mart as a real estate liquidation company, not a retailer. They were running low on good locations to sell, so they went after Sears. They'll slap the Sears name on a bunch of locations they haven't been able to sell, and probably close about that many Sears stores to liqudate the real estate.

Years ago, I worked in the plumbing & hardware dept. at Sears for a while. A certain element would occasionally march in and demand refunds for Craftsman power tools that they had obviously just bought at garage sales. The persistent ones got their refunds. That was what really opened my eyes to the greatness of that motto above the doors. Since then, all of my major appliance purchases have been from Sears.

If they don't add something like "certain restrictions apply" to that guarantee emblazoned above the doors, the persistent ones will continue to get their refunds.
